Novel Potentiometric Sensors of Molecular Imprinted Polymers for Specific Binding of Chlormequat

Abstract:Molecularly imprinted polymers (MIP) were used as potentiometric sensors for the selective recognition and determination of chlormequat (CMQ). They were produced after radical polymerization of 4‐vinyl pyridine (4‐VP) or methacrylic acid (MAA) monomers in the presence of a cross‐linker. CMQ was used as template. Similar non‐imprinted (NI) polymers (NIP) were produced by removing the template from reaction media. The effect of kind and amount of MIP or NIP sensors on the potentiometric behavior was investigated. Main analytical features were evaluated in steady and flow modes of operation. The sensor MIP/4‐VP exhibited the best performance, presenting fast near‐Nernstian response for CMQ over the concentration range 6.2×10?6–1.0×10?2 mol L?1 with detection limits of 4.1×10?6 mol L?1. The sensor was independent from the pH of test solutions in the range 5–10. Potentiometric selectivity coefficients of the proposed sensors were evaluated over several inorganic and organic cations. Results pointed out a good selectivity to CMQ. The sensor was applied to the potentiometric determination of CMQ in commercial phytopharmaceuticals and spiked water samples. Recoveries ranged 96 to 108.5%.
